1/5 stars - Disappointing Experience at Babbas Chicken I visited Babbas Chicken on Thursday, December 5th, around 7 pm, and had a thoroughly disappointing experience. The drive-thru wait was 15 minutes, which was tolerable. However, the service was subpar. When I ordered a BBQ chicken, the server didn't respond and walked away. She returned to inform me that they were out of BBQ chicken but offered charcoal chicken, which would take 10 minutes. The staff member struggled to communicate my order back to me. After waiting an additional 20 minutes, I received a bag dripping with oil, which leaked all over my car's cloth seats. I returned to the restaurant, and they rewrapped the chicken. I also requested serviettes to clean the mess, which they provided. What's appalling is that despite multiple calls and filling out their contact form on the same day, I received zero contact from the restaurant to discuss my experience. The cherry on top is that the oil stain on my seat cost me over $100 to remove. The chicken itself was quite nice, but the service and overall experience were abysmal. Unless they seriously revamp their service and communication, I wouldn't recommend Babbas Chicken to anyone.

Absolutely love the BBQ Chicken, but mostly LOVE the charcoal chicken. Unfortunately, it is only available 1/10 I go...(Which is usually 3x per week). As a Charcoal chicken shop, I think the Charcoal chickens should be the 1st priority to start cooking everyday, but alas, they are not. You arrive at lunchtime, ask for Charcoal, only to be told "We've only just put them on. They will be atleast another 2.5hrs"🤯🤯🤯 Seriously!!! & I'm not the only 1 with that opinion. & they never cook enough of them.- Usually if you get there past 6.30pm, it's "Sorry, but we've sold out for today"🤦🏻‍♀️🫠 With the amount of people that ask, & then are denied Charcoal, proves that you need to be cooking more of them. Chips are usually always great.- Only every now & again they're not cooked properly, & there's no crunch to them. Wish you would offer an Extra small though, as they're not cheap, & a small is generally too much for 1 person. Salad portions are small for the price, those prices need to drop, or give bigger portions. As is the amount of vegetables you get (apart from peas🙄), in any meal pack, or ordering by themselves...Which is a shame, as the pumpkin is especially nice, but you don't get enough, or corn.... So yeah..Not like you will actually care about this review, but main ideas: - Charcoal chicken: This especially should be ready from the time you open, not halfway during the afternoons. Chips:- make chips cheaper, or offer smaller sizes. Salads:- Make them Cheaper, or give bigger portions.(They're half the price at Coles & Woolworths.... plus you'd probably sell more) Vegetables:- WAY WAY WAY overpriced for what you get... It's actually sad, & is why I stopped buying your "Meal Deals", they just aren't worth it.- It may take 2 stops, But you get Chicken, chips & Gravy here, then stop in at Coles to get some different salads, then = 1/2 the price of your meal deals) ... Gravy: Overpriced for sizes when it's just chicken juices, fat, some flavouring & cornstarch..... Also.... You would think that you had started a loyalty program by now.... like most places... but you haven't....ANOTHER thing you should add... I probably would have earnt 5 chickens in the past 6...

Could be a lot better without even trying very hard.

$23 for 1/4 chook and chips, coleslaw and small drink is quite exxie for what the place is. I'll pay that if the place is nice, has an ok atmosphere and the food is good; happily.. I am not hating on them for the price, but it's the price of a restaurant. This place is hot, kinda loud and open onto the busy Reservoir Road.

I stood at the counter (the only customer) and wasnt acknowledged for a couple of minutes. That to me just doesn't make sense; if you're busy with something yell out hello or tell me you'll be a second .. There are two plastic chairs to the whole place, you're pointed to a empty container that apparently used to hold plastic knives and forks, food is served to you in a brown paper bag... again, all of these things are ok if it was half the price.
